Iris Hanika
German writer (born 1962)
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Iris Hanika (born 1962) is a German writer.[1] She was born in Würzburg, grew up in Bad Königshofen and has lived in Berlin since 1979, where she studied Universal and Comparative Literature at the FU Berlin.[2][3][4] She was a regular contributor to German periodicals like Frankfurter Allgemeine Zeitung (freelancer of the Berliner Seiten) and Merkur (2000–2008: column Chronicles). Hanika won the LiteraTour Nord prize and the EU Prize for Literature for her novel Das Eigentliche (The Bottom Line). In 2020, she was awarded the Hermann-Hesse-Literaturpreis for her novel Echos Kammern. In 2021, she won the Leipzig Book Fair Prize.[5] Hanika wrote previously mainly short non-fictional texts, later novels, including two books on psychoanalysis.[6]

Awards
- 2006 Hans Fallada Prize[7]
- 2010 European Union Prize for Literature for Das Eigentliche[7]
- 2011 Preis der LiteraTour Nord for Das Eigentliche[7]
- 2017/2018 Villa Massimo[6]
- 2020 Hermann-Hesse-Literaturpreis for Echos Kammern[7]
- 2021 Leipzig Book Fair Prize for Echos Kammern[7]
